WIT Fitness sponsors Team Myzone at the HYROX World Championships
by Ben Hackney-Williams on Friday, 13 May 2022
To race well you need to feel prepared, to feel ready and, most importantly, feel comfortable. WIT Fitness know this better than anyone, and has stepped up as sponsor for Team Myzone for the HYROX World Championships in Las Vegas.
This weekend sees some of the world’s fittest individuals come together to compete at the HYROX World Championships in Las Vegas.
With over 20 countries represented, 1200 competitors and a single day of sweaty competition, it’s set to be a phenomenal display of passion for physical activity.
What’s more, those competing from Team Myzone are very much ready for the challenge.
